Makes 8 (1-cup) servings.
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 20 minutes
INGREDIENTS
1 pound lean ground beef
1 medium onion, chopped
1 package McCormick® Taco Seasoning Mix
2 cups water
1 can (15 ounces) diced tomatoes
1 can (15 ounces) tomato sauce
1 cup frozen whole kernel corn
2 cups uncooked elbow macaroni
1 cup shredded Cheddar cheese
DIRECTIONS
1. Brown beef and onion in large skillet on medium-high heat. Drain fat.
2. Stir in Seasoning Mix, water, diced tomatoes, tomato sauce and corn. Bring to boil. Add pasta. Reduce heat to low; cover and simmer 12 minutes, stirring occasionally.
3. Sprinkle with cheese, cover. Let stand 5 minutes or until cheese is melted.
Tips
A Taste For Health Tip: To reduce sodium to 352mg per serving, switch to McCormick® 30% Reduced Sodium Taco Seasoning, no salt added diced tomatoes, and no salt added tomato sauce - a savings of 420mg sodium!
